Capturing good lighting in photography is an artwork type that requires a mix of technical ability and intuition. Understanding the various aspects of light can greatly enhance the standard of your pictures. Light can both make or break an image, and understanding tips on how to use it successfully can rework odd subjects into beautiful visuals.


Natural gentle is usually thought of the solely option for photography, as it supplies a delicate, even illumination that can be flattering to most topics. The golden hour, which occurs shortly after sunrise and before sunset, presents a heat diffused gentle that can elevate your outside images. This time of day creates long shadows and a unique environment that attracts the viewer's eye, making it a favorite among photographers.


Understanding the position of the sun throughout the day might help you intend your shoots strategically - Local Photographers Orlando. Midday solar may be harsh and unflattering, creating deep shadows that may distort your topic. In this case, using shade or discovering a more favorable location can help you capture higher lighting without the extremes of brightness.


When taking pictures indoors, window light is a incredible choice to assume about. Natural gentle filtering by way of windows provides a gentle, pleasing quality to pictures. Positioning your topic close to the window can create lovely highlights and shadows, amplifying texture and depth in your pictures. Curtains or sheer cloth can diffuse the light even further, preventing harsh contrasts.

Artificial lighting can also play a significant position in photography. Understanding the varied forms of light sources—such as LED lights, strobes, and continuous lights—allows for versatile taking pictures options. Using softboxes or reflectors can help soften harsh shadows and control the direction of the light. This makes it simpler to attain the specified mood and aesthetic.


Experimenting with light modifiers can lead to thrilling outcomes. Umbrellas and softboxes can spread and diffuse mild, creating a delicate, flattering glow round your topics. Conversely, using grid spots or snoots can create dramatic shadows and defined highlights, which might improve specific components within your frame. Every modification permits for artistic exploration and can drastically change the final photograph.


Another aspect to suppose about is the white balance in your digital camera settings. Different gentle sources have unique colour temperatures that may affect the general look of your pictures. Using the right settings ensures that colours seem extra pure. Auto white balance works in lots of instances, however guide changes can provide larger management, especially in blended lighting conditions.

Understanding the idea of exposure is essential when capturing perfect lighting. A well-exposed photograph balances the light throughout the scene, capturing details in both highlights and shadows. The three major components to achieve this balance are aperture, shutter pace, and ISO. Adjusting these settings can enable for exquisite renditions of sunshine, whether or not you desire a shallow depth of field or to freeze movement in bright situations.


Utilizing the histogram on your digital camera can be an invaluable tool. It supplies a visual illustration of the tonal vary in your image, serving to you make changes in real time. By maintaining your histogram within the boundaries, you presumably can avoid clipped highlights and deep shadows that can detract from the good thing about your composition.


Post-processing is a wonderful approach to refine the lighting in your pictures additional. Software like Adobe Lightroom or Photoshop presents varied tools to boost exposure, distinction, and shade steadiness. You can make delicate adjustments that may dramatically enhance how mild interacts along with your photograph, bringing out details which will have been misplaced straight out of the digicam.

Incorporating out of doors parts can also improve the lighting of your pictures. Reflective surfaces, like water or sand, can bounce gentle onto your topic, creating a unique and fascinating glow. Similarly, city environments filled with glass and steel can present interesting reflections and high-contrast gentle patterns, including depth and complexity to your photos.


For photographers who wish to push creative boundaries, capturing in low-light situations can yield fascinating outcomes. This situation requires a great understanding of your digicam's capabilities as properly as a steady hand or a tripod. Low mild can create moody, atmospheric images that capture emotion and intrigue. Experimenting with longer exposures can lead to beautiful visuals that showcase movement and light in distinctive ways.


Always remember that follow makes good. Regularly experimenting with different lighting circumstances and settings will refine your capacity to seize the best gentle possible. Keeping a journal or log concerning what works and what doesn’t might help in understanding how different gentle influences your style and results.
